Language
The official language of Azerbaijan is Azerbaijani. However, Russian is also widely spoken, especially in major cities like Sumqayit and Baku. English is not as common, but it is understood in some tourist areas.
Currency
The currency of Azerbaijan is the Azerbaijani manat (AZN). It is advisable to exchange your currency before arriving in Azerbaijan, as the exchange rates at the airport may not be favorable.

What to Eat
Azerbaijani cuisine is known for its delicious and flavorful dishes. Here are a few must-try dishes in Zabrat:
- Plov: A traditional rice dish cooked with meat, vegetables, and spices.
- Dolma: Stuffed grape leaves or vegetables with rice, meat, and herbs.
- Kebab: Grilled meat skewers served with rice or vegetables.
